What Is Location Data Infrastructure?
Location data infrastructure is an essential tool for any business looking to leverage the power of location data. Location data infrastructure is a combination of hardware, software and network components that enables businesses to collect, store, analyse and interpret data about the physical locations of customers, employees, products and services.
Through this infrastructure, businesses can gain valuable insights into their customer's behaviour, preferences and movements and use this data to optimise their operations, products and services.
Location data infrastructure is comprised of a variety of different components, including:
- Geospatial data: This includes geographic data such as roads, points of interest, and addresses. This data is usually collected and stored in a Geographic Information System (GIS).
- Location-based services: These services allow businesses to access real-time location data from mobile devices and other sources.
- Location analytics software: This software enables businesses to analyse location data and extract insights.
- Location-aware applications: These are applications that are designed to leverage location data to deliver more personalised experiences to users.
- Location-based marketing: This is a form of marketing that uses location data to target customers with relevant messages and offers.
- Location intelligence platforms: These platforms provide businesses with an end-to-end solution for collecting, analysing, and leveraging location data.
What Can Location Data Infrastructure Do for Your Business?
1. Improve Customer Experience
By understanding the data on where customers are located and how they move, businesses can tailor their services to ensure that customers receive the best possible experience when interacting with their business. This can include everything from providing nearby locations of their stores or services to providing recommendations of nearby points of interest to ensuring that customers are receiving the best possible deals and discounts.
2. Get More Efficient Operations
Businesses can better optimise their processes and operations by analysing customers' movements and paths to save time and money. For example, businesses can use this data to understand better how customers move around their stores and adjust their layout accordingly to improve customer flow and reduce bottlenecks.
Additionally, businesses can use this data to optimise their delivery and logistics operations, ensuring that products and services are delivered to customers in the most efficient manner possible.
3. Increase Revenue
Location data infrastructure can identify areas of opportunity to serve their customers better, such as by offering specialised products or services in certain locations. Additionally, businesses can use location data to identify customer trends and develop targeted marketing campaigns.
4. Create More Personalized Digital and Physical Experiences
LDI can help you to create more personalised digital and physical experiences. With the right LDI, you can better track customer movements and interactions to understand their behaviour and preferences and create tailored digital and physical experiences. This can help to build loyalty and keep customers coming back, which can have a significant impact on your bottom line.
